#ca9e0c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ca9e0c is composed of 79.2% red, 62%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.8% magenta, 94.1%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 46.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 42%. #ca9e0c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ff18 with #953d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#ca9e0c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ca9e0c has RGB values of R:202, G:158,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.94,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13278732.

Hex triplet ca9e0c #ca9e0c
RGB Decimal 202, 158, 12 rgb(202,158,12)
RGB Percent 79.2, 62, 4.7 rgb(79.2%,62%,4.7%)
CMYK 0, 22, 94, 21
HSL 46.1°, 88.8, 42 hsl(46.1,88.8%,42%)
HSV (or HSB) 46.1°, 94.1, 79.2
Web Safe cc9900 #cc9900
CIE-LAB 67.306, 4.853, 69.402
XYZ 36.651, 37.039, 5.567
xyY 0.462, 0.467, 37.039
CIE-LCH 67.306, 69.572, 86
CIE-LUV 67.306, 37.551, 69.207
Hunter-Lab 60.859, 0.993, 37.179
Binary 11001010, 10011110, 00001100

Shades and Tints of #ca9e0c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110d01 is the darkest color, while #fffffd is the lightest one.
